    Photos are an amazing source of re-living the past and remembering happy moments.  To remind the past good old days and give a glimpse of experiences in Israel to the families and the general public in Nepal, the Embassy of Israel along with Shalom Club Nepal organized 'Shalom Photo Exhibition' on 08 February 2014 at Café Des Arts, Thamel. 
     
    The pictures captured by Nepali participants, who went for various MASHAV courses in Israel, in different years (some pictures dated as old as 1970s) were showcased during the exhibition.
     
    Inaugurating the exhibition, H.E. Mr. Hanan Goder, Ambassador of Israel to Nepal said, "This cooperation between Nepal and Israel lasts for more than 5 decades.  I am proud to be a part of this program that brings our two nations together."
     
    Dr. Rabindra Kumar Shakya, Vice Chairman of National Planning Commission and Shalom Club President was the chief guest of the program. Dr. Buland Thapa, Director of Bir Hospital and the 4 winners of Photo Exhibition shared their feeling about the program and also shared their MASHAV experience in Israel.
     
    The exhibition will continue for a week, from 9-22 February 2014, at Café Des Arts for the general viewing by the public.
     
    Editor's Note:
    Altogether 44 photos were exhibited that were taken in Israel at different locations belonging to various Shalom Club Nepal members.
     
    SHALOM Club is a non-governmental, non-profitable organization.  All the participants who go to Israel for a MASHAV training automatically becomes a member of Shalom Club.  As of now there are more than 7000 members at this club only in Nepal, since the day it was established in 1960s.  Shalom Club partners with Israeli Embassy in Nepal to conduct various environmental and voluntary works.
